From the 650 ml. bottle. Sampled on July 1, 2014.

The pour is a cloudy pale yellow with a short-lived white head.

Aroma of thin wheat and sour malt esters.

The body is thinner than I hoped but not bad.

The taste has a mild sourness to it that does not cause me to pucker up like similar brews can. I found it to be quite drinkable on this 92 degree sunny day.

Appearance: Arrives with a honey color and a moderately sized head that leaves a few strips of lace

Smell: Toasted wheat bread and tart elements

Taste: Toasted wheat bread, up front, with a sour finish

Mouthfeel: Light body with moderate carbonation

Overall: A very nice example of the style

I really enjoyed this true-to-type Berliner Weisse.

A: very pale yellow color, ever so slight haze, poured with copious creamy head that kept thin lacing nearly to end
S: medium nose, grassy, lemony, sour, very nice
T: nicely balanced, good tartness with some grassy undertones and earthy qualities
M: very drinkable and refreshing
O: this is one of the better made Berliner Weisse in the country, well done
